Re: X41 CF to IDE which should I choose ?

#4 Post by sjthinkpader » Mon Jan 18, 2010 7:27 am

No soldering for CF adapters. They don't have 3.3V regulators since CF cards work in both 5V and 3.3V slots.

Yes, 233x or faster cards to be reasonably usable.
